LCI Industries Inc supplies domestically and internationally components for the original equipment manufacturers of recreational vehicles and adjacent industries, including buses and trailers used to haul boats, livestock, equipment, and other cargo. It has two reportable segments: the original equipment manufacturers segment and the aftermarket segment. The OEM Segment manufactures or distributes components for the OEMs of RVs and adjacent industries, including buses; trailers used to haul boats, livestock, equipment, and other cargo; trucks; pontoon boats; trains; manufactured homes; and modular housing. Its products are sold to manufacturers of RVs such as Thor Industries, Forest River, Winnebago, and other RV OEMs, and to manufacturers in adjacent industries.
FS KKR Capital Corp is an externally managed, non-diversified, closed-end management investment company that has elected to be regulated as a business development company. The company's investment objectives are to generate current income and, to a lesser extent, long-term capital appreciation. The company's portfolio is comprised of investments in senior secured loans and second lien secured loans of private middle market U.S. companies and, to a lesser extent, subordinated loans and certain asset-based financing loans of private U.S. companies.
